What does an events manager do?

An Events Manager is responsible for planning, organizing, and overseeing events such as conferences, exhibitions, weddings, and corporate functions. They coordinate all aspects of the event, including budgeting, selecting venues, managing vendors, and ensuring the event runs smoothly. Events Managers also handle logistics, supervise staff, and address any issues that arise during the event. Their goal is to create memorable and successful experiences for clients and attendees.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be an events manager?

To thrive as an Events Manager,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and experience in planning and coordinating events, often supported by a degree in hospitality, marketing, or a related field. Familiarity with event management software, budgeting tools, and customer relationship management (CRM) systems is typically required. Exceptional communication, problem-solving abilities, and leadership are vital soft skills for managing teams and client expectations. These skills and qualities ensure seamless event execution, client satisfaction, and the ability to handle the dynamic challenges of event management.

What challenges do events managers face when coordinating large-scale events, and how can they be addressed?

One of the main challenges Events Managers encounter during large-scale events is ensuring seamless coordination among multiple vendors, stakeholders, and team members. Issues such as last-minute changes, technical difficulties, and unexpected weather conditions can arise. To address these challenges, it’s important to develop detailed contingency plans, maintain clear communication channels, and conduct regular check-ins with all involved parties. Building strong relationships with reliable vendors and fostering a collaborative team environment also help ensure successful event execution.

What is the difference between Events Manager vs Event Coordinator?

AspectEvents ManagerEvent Coordinator
CredentialsRelevant experience, certifications like CMP or CSEP often preferredSimilar credentials, often entry-level or related certifications
Work EnvironmentOversees multiple events, manages teams, strategic planningHandles specific event details, logistics, and on-site coordination
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in corporate, non-profit, and hospitality sectorsCommon in event planning companies, venues, and corporate events
Search & Comparison IntentPeople looking for senior or managerial event rolesIndividuals seeking entry-level or operational roles in events

The main difference between an Events Manager and an Event Coordinator lies in scope and responsibility. Events Managers typically oversee multiple events, handle strategic planning, and manage teams, while Event Coordinators focus on executing specific event details and logistics. Both roles require similar credentials, but the Events Manager position usually involves higher-level management and broader oversight.

About the Venue
Located in historic downtown Provo, Utah the Utah Valley Convention Center opened its doors in 2012 as the premiere meeting space in Utah County. The UVCC boasts the perfect blend of modern architecture, flexible meeting space, and breathtaking interior and exterior views of the nearby Wasatch Mountains. This combined with its functional floor plan makes it the perfect venue to host any event.
